终于把我万年没升级的firefox扔了,重新下了一个

  1. 下载:
    Software - Tete's Atelier

  2. 便携:据说这个更好:
    libportable download | SourceForge.net
    (如果firefox已经有数据)原Firefox在地址栏输入about:support,点击"显示文件夹"按钮打开profile目录。
    提取portable64.dll复制为tmemutil.dll,提取portable(example).ini复制为portable.ini
    重新运行firefox,同样显示profile文件夹位置,关闭firefox然后将原profile目录内容转移过来。

  3. 扩展:

    • 划词翻译(Chrome有)
    • 拷贝猫(Chrome有)
    • 缩放(Chrome有,作者Stefan vd)
    • 找回已关闭的标签页
    • Auto Tab Discard(Chrome有)
    • Bitwarden(Chrome有)
    • CopyTabTitleUrl
    • Feedbro(Chrome有)
    • Improved History(仿Chrome的Better History)
    • LastPass(Chrome有)
    • Omni(Chrome有,但是百分版本太低装不上)
    • Paste and Go Key
    • Paxmod(多行标签,扩展商店未上架,需要手动导入)
    • Print Edit WE
    • Proxy SwitchyOmega(Chrome有)
    • QR Code – 下载 🦊 Firefox 扩展(zh-CN) (对标百分内置的地址框里的二维码)
    • Reload in address bar(这个貌似是firefox砍掉的老功能)
    • ScrollAnywhere(Chrome有)
    • Sidebery(代替Tree Style Tab可惜tab session快照不能更名,不然连session buddy的活也干了
    • SingleFile(Chrome有)
    • smartUp手势(Chrome有)
    • Stylus(Chrome有)
    • Swift Selection Search(搜索引擎自定义完全对标Chrome的searchbar)
    • Tab Manager Plus(Chrome有)
    • Tab Session Manager(Chrome有,保存tab session,用来代替session buddy)
    • Tampermonkey(Chrome有)
    • uBlock Origin(Chrome有)+uMatrix(Chrome有)
    • Yet Another Smooth Scrolling WE
  4. 目前发现的问题:

    • 简悦没有firefox扩展,不过我油猴里有个早就下架的脚本
    • mega.nz没有firefox扩展,不过我很少用它,而且这个网盘本身就利用浏览器localstorage的,没扩展大差不差
    • Github的油猴脚本不能用,貌似CSP策略问题——用扩展修改响应头中的content-security-policy失败,后来用Gooreplacer直接拦截成功。
    • 划词翻译扩展的 DeepL 会出现“加载超时”的错误。扩展的帮助文档里提到了是Firefox 100+版本后出现的。( firefox 100 使用 deepl 免费试用时加载超时 · Issue #1379 · hcfyapp/crx-selection-translate · GitHub )
    • Tab Session Manager可以导入Session Buddy的记录,但得注意按照前者帮助文档来,不然会一脸懵。我导出666条导入665条,查了半天发现有一条是空的。——20220630补充:导入的session还是好多残缺不全;Tab Session Manager有过滤功能(Session Buddy每次都会把我固定的标签页一并保存进来)但是“附加当前窗口标签页”的时候就不过滤,也有其他用户提issue了( Make ignore list work on "add the current window" · Issue #967 · sienori/Tab-Session-Manager · GitHub )。
2 个赞

我习惯用 MyFirefox 引导启动,可设置默认浏览器,升级后不用打补丁

说几个目前没找到 WE 扩展替代的
addMenuPlus.uc.js
textZoomPerDomain_e10s.uc.js
privateTab.uc.js
KeyChanger.uc.js
extensionOptionsMenu.uc.js

我總覺的firefox比chromium好用,除非遇上無法解決的問題,但至今並沒有。

用了十多年,从来不用什么便携版,增强版,以及各种DIY版,一直是国际版。

3 个赞

我之前用的是奶酪的改版,是基于国际版改的,用起来很舒服

正常,我也是找个tete009,然后从头导数据(chrome的收藏夹和各种扩展配置)。而且对便携其实要求不高

我一直用国际版,换电脑的话就直接迁移一下配置文件夹。

惭愧,我还没用过uc.js,只用过userChrome去掉标签页的关闭按钮

1 个赞

更新一下目前火狐扩展现状:
火狐是Tete编译版,112.0.2 (64 位)

删除线代表禁用(但还留着)

  • Bonjourr·极简首页
    • 2nVzlQADDIE,7gyACbSEsnM,4643622,1073617,317099
  • Circle阅读助手
  • Container Tab Groups
  • ContextSearch web-ext
    • 对标searchbar
  • Custom Scrollbars
  • Feedbro
  • Firefox Multi-Account Containers
    • 身份容器已经是我用Firefox的主要原因了
  • Global Speed
  • Gooreplacer
  • IDM Integration Module
  • Improved History
  • Lastpass
  • LoadTabOnSelect3
  • Markdown Viewer
  • MySessions
  • Paste and Go Key
  • Paxmod
    • 配合Vivaldi Fox会闪瞎狗眼
  • PWA for Firefox
  • Print Edit WE
  • QR Code
  • Reload in address bar
  • Roboform
  • ScrollAnywhere
  • SingleFile
  • SmartProxy
    • 取代Proxy SwitchyOmega
  • smartUp手势
  • Stylus
  • Tab Session Manager
  • Tampermonkey
  • uBlock Origin
  • uMatrix
  • Wikiwand
  • Yet Another Smooth Scrolling WE
  • 找回已关闭的标签页
  • 拷贝猫
  • 暴力猴
  • 沉浸式翻译
  • 划词翻译
  • 沙拉查词
  • 缩放

但仍有个问题就是用久了内存占用很大

我理解,实际上便携性要求不高,需要同步的只有书签,标签页等非必须非经常性的,可以通过onetab等扩展方式变相解决。
扩展记得安装就行。
所以只要在profile.ini里面指定数据主目录,然后同步书签数据库文件sqlite就行了吧?

二维码我喜欢用这个

好家伙,这么多扩展,占用能不大ma